Transaction 58a71eda4cc14fc4e1f41c18d8d2613ba8b42108b041c92a1fcbea107b9fad58
2 Input
2 Outputs
- 58a71eda4cc14fc4e1f41c18d8d2613ba8b42108b041c92a1fcbea107b9fad58:0
- 58a71eda4cc14fc4e1f41c18d8d2613ba8b42108b041c92a1fcbea107b9fad58:1
value 400000
address 1FdoNiZsozRTNbh5xTUomtrMBcFCQ2jEJq
value 1928372
address 1EpFn8eiBRr5dv3pUQC4L5Gjg3BJqWAAfq